**Vendor note: Inkmill markdown pipeline**

Rendering for Parchway docs is outsourced to Inkmill under an annual contract, renewing each March. They handle sanitization and PDF export; we own the upload queue. SLA: 4-hour response on rendering failures. Escalate only after two failed retries. Their support desk is reachable at the address below.

billing contact of hahaf-baguf = zorael.tammir.jorius@sivrelhq.internal

## Artifact signing — Quillstream compactor builds

Quick note for on-call: the log-compaction worker ships as a signed artifact, same as the broker itself. If compaction stalls and you need to hot-deploy a patched worker, it still has to pass signature checks or the broker refuses to load it. No unsigned emergency builds, ever. Verify any compactor artifact against the key that follows.

release key, fahaf-bajof: bky3_Xam

## Role-based access for plugin authors

Plugins on the Quillhaven wiki inherit the permissions of the invoking user, never the plugin owner. Requests to restricted namespaces return a 403 with a role hint in the body; do not retry with elevated scopes. Custom roles must be registered before your plugin can reference them. To see which roles and scope mappings the current instance exposes, consult the values below.

config for yagep-yageg:
[holius]
host = holius.zemvarsys.local
user = holius_svc
database = holius_prod

## Changelog — sqlcheck defaults

Heads up, new folks: we flipped the default linting rules for SQL files in the Marlinbrook repo. Uppercase keywords are now enforced, and trailing semicolons are required. Old migrations are grandfathered in, so don't panic about red squiggles there. The active defaults the linter ships with are listed below.

config for yajep-tafof:
[rusath]
team = julmir
access_code = ac_fe37fd
host = rusath.novactech.test
port = 8000
owner = pelmir.weneth
peer = oliwyn.olvarqdyn.internal